Management highlights

• In fiscal 2024, despite challenging industry dynamics, Clearfield focused on investing in the business, built stronger customer relationships, launched new products to reduce deployment time, and optimized cost and operating structure. • Looked forward to opportunities from public and private funding for rural broadband expansion, introducing products like SeeChange, CraftSmart FiberFirst Pedestal, CraftSmart Deploy Reel TAP Box, FiberFlex series of active cabinets, and a 3D interactive fiber installation tool via the BILT mobile app. • Anis Khemakhem joined the company and was promoted to Chief Marketing Officer; Kevin Morgan will continue in an advisory capacity. • Noted that inventory overhang was mainly at MSO accounts, while the Community Broadband segment and large regional providers had recovered to a normal ordering cadence.

Segment performance

Consolidated net sales in the fourth quarter of fiscal 2024 were $46.8 million, a 6% decrease from $49.7 million in the same year - ago period but above the guidance range of $40 million to $43 million. This included $35.7 million of North American net sales and $11.1 million of international net sales. For the full fiscal year, consolidated net sales were $166.7 million, a 38% decrease from $268.7 million in fiscal 2023. Revenue from homes connected continued to represent a larger portion of overall revenue relative to comparable year - ago periods.

Guidance

• Anticipates revenues of $170 million to $185 million for fiscal year 2025. • Expects U.S. revenue growth to be in line or above industry - focused forecasts with minimal revenue growth in the international market, focusing on gross profit improvements. • Sees a somewhat slow start to fiscal 2025 with first - quarter net sales in the range of $33 million to $38 million. • Projects net loss per share in the first quarter of fiscal 2025 to be in the range of $0.28 to $0.35. • Anticipates growth to accelerate with the positive impact of BEAD funding in 2026 and beyond, especially in rural markets where Clearfield is strong.
